Overview

Examines the experiences of black laborers on white farms after they were forced off their own land. Racist policies throughout southern Africa consciously drove African farmers off their land during the first half of the 20th century and forced them to become laborers on white farms. This set of essays explore various aspects ofthe lives and experiences of these black farm workers.
